Transaction 56dcc3112ccb23bc0aa794dee04c37170a7682f539af0a39094f4672cd784e8f
2 Input
2 Outputs
- 56dcc3112ccb23bc0aa794dee04c37170a7682f539af0a39094f4672cd784e8f:0
- 56dcc3112ccb23bc0aa794dee04c37170a7682f539af0a39094f4672cd784e8f:1
value 957673
address 1CnnE39t3EDJbHmHgPSHcSDE4MkSjKxRcA
value 173784
address 1KAqFBuN4UzG5KkFUSqR4gAZHDiK1qzqZc